Global Studies Programs

Students may choose a major or a minor global studies. The global studies major culminates in a Bachelor of Arts degree.

Major coursework consists of the required University Core 39 and electives from various disciplines, including:

  • Anthropology
  • Art
  • Communications
  • Economics
  • English
  • History
  • Natural Sciences
  • Political Science
  • World Languages and Cultures

Students must complete a minimum of two years (four semesters) or equivalent study in one non-English world language.

Core 39
In addition to the departmental degree requirements, undergraduate students must complete the University Core 39. Our core provides the foundation for all baccalaureate degrees at the University of Southern Indiana.
